**Ticket THMB-412: Vault locked, thumbnail queue stalled**

The Greymarsh thumbnail generation queue halted at 03:10 after the signing vault sealed itself during failover. Workers can't fetch resize credentials; backlog growing ~400 jobs/min. Release is blocked until the vault is unsealed. Do not restart workers first — they'll poison the retry queue. Unseal using the passphrase below.

vault phrase of bagaf-kajeg = jorath-feniel-briir-siliel-ralix

Subject: SDK parity ownership change

Team,

Effective next sprint, responsibility for feature parity between the Lanternfish Java SDK and the Lanternfish Go SDK moves out of the platform group. Parity gaps should no longer be filed against the core runtime board; use the new SDK Parity queue instead. Existing tickets will be triaged and migrated over the next two weeks. For escalations and roadmap questions, the new owner of parity work is listed below.

named custodian: Brivan Eliath Quenox Frador

## Break-Glass: Mapkeet Offline Mode

Support can unlock a surveyor's stuck offline queue without engineering approval in emergencies. Use this only when sync has failed for over 24 hours and data loss is likely. Open the device's recovery screen and enter the break-glass passphrase listed below.

recovery phrase for tagug-yagug: lamox-gilax-keleth-gilath

MEMO — Budget Request, Kestrel Line Expansion

To the Board: Operations requests 2.4M for retooling the Farrowgate plant to support the Kestrel line. Breakdown: 1.6M equipment, 0.5M training, 0.3M contingency. Payback modelled at 26 months, assuming current order volume from Ostermann Retail holds. Alternative of outsourcing to Vexley Fabrication was costed and rejected on margin grounds. Approval requested before the 14th to secure supplier pricing. The broader strategic context is summarised in the confidential note below.

board note of fahif-yahog: Gross margin on Wenath came in at 10 percent against a plan of 5 percent. Only 3 of the 100 pilot accounts renewed Wenath, so a churn review is set for July 15.

## Data Stores: Export Memory Usage

The Tallyvane spreadsheet exporter streams rows in 5k chunks to cap memory at roughly 300 MB per job. Peak usage per export is logged to the `export_metrics` table for the weekly sync review. To query recent peaks directly, connect to the metrics replica with the string below.

replica DSN, kajep-yahag: mssql://praok_svc:iF@db-8d68.plorvaio.local:5432/eliion